Journal: bioRxiv
Article Title: The abnormal C-terminus in DVL1 impacts Robinow Syndrome phenotypes
doi: 10.64898/2026.02.14.705933
Figure Lengend Snippet: A) Mesenchymal cells harvested from the frontonasal mass of stage 24 (E4.5) embryos and were plated into high-density cultures. B) Other cultures were sectioned and used for microscopic analysis. C,E-H) There is a significant decrease in the proportion of cartilage from the DVL1 1519ΔT variant compared to the wtDVL1 infected cultures as measured in wholemount stained cultures. When the DVL1 1519* truncation was compared to wtDVL1 there was no significant difference in the Alcian blue stained area. The DVL1 1519* construct reduced cartilage compared to GFP controls. D,I-L) The cultures were significantly thinner in the presence of the DVL1 1519ΔT variant compared to w tDVL1 or the GFP controls. The DVL1 1519 * construct slightly reduced the thickness of the cartilage compared to GFP controls. M) The viruses containing human DVL1 constructs were expressed at similar levels in primary mesenchyme as determined by qRT-PCR with human-specific DVL1 primers. Generally the human DVL1 gene expression was elevated 10 to 15-fold by the viral transgenesis. N, O) The 1519ΔT virus significantly reduced expression of TWIST2 , MMP13 and LEF1 . P,Q) Two reporters were used in micromass cultures from frontonasal mass cells, the SuperTOPFlash reporter for canonical WNT signaling and ATF2 for JNK-PCP, non-canonical WNT signaling. The wt DVL1 plasmid significantly activated both reporters. In comparison both 1519ΔT and 1519* viruses did not activate the reporters as much as wt DVL1 . They did retain more activity than the control, parent plasmid. Statistical analysis done with one-way ANOVA followed by Dunnett’s multiple comparison test ( M ) or Tukey’s post-hoc test (C,D,N,O,P,Q). Scale bar in E-H = 2 mm, I-L = 20µm.

Journal: bioRxiv
Article Title: A synNotch-based morphogen detection system reveals sFRP2 enhances Wnt3a signaling
doi: 10.64898/2026.02.09.704138
Figure Lengend Snippet: (A) Schematic illustration of HEK293T cells expressing TOPFlash mCherry reporter. (B) TOPFlash reporter assay with recombinant sFRP2. Reporter cells were incubated with the conditioned media harvested from GFP-Wnt3a-secreting cells and supplemented with various concentrations of recombinant sFRP2. The conditioned media were applied either at full concentration (right) or diluted with an equivalent volume of DMEM (left). After 48-h incubation, the mCherry reporter activation was measured by flow cytometry. The potentiating effect of sFRP2 on Wnt signaling was pronounced under the diluted conditions (left). (C) Experimental setup for the gradient assay. GFP-Wnt3a-secreting L cells (1.6×10 4 cells) were seeded into the left chamber, while HEK293T TOPFlash reporter cells (1.6×10 4 cells) were seeded into the right chamber. After incubation overnight, the insert was removed, and the media were replaced with 1% agarose-containing media. Standard DMEM or DMEM containing recombinant sFRP2 was subsequently added over the solidified agarose gel. The confocal images were acquired at 24 h intervals. (D) Gradient patterns after 4 days of incubation. The spatial distribution of mCherry signals was extended in an sFRP2-dose-dependent manner. Red lines indicate the mean mCherry intensity derived from 5 subdivided vertical regions per image. Specifically, each 900-pixel vertical image was partitioned into 5 equal segments of 180 pixels each. The mean fluorescence intensity was calculated for each segment, and the red line represents the average of these five regional means. Shaded areas in the graph represent the ±SD. Scale bar: 200 µm.

Journal: Journal of Advanced Research
Article Title: Circular RNA circATM binds PARP1 to suppress Wnt/β-catenin signaling and induce cell cycle arrest in gastric cancer cells
doi: 10.1016/j.jare.2025.04.033
Figure Lengend Snippet: CircATM binding to PARP1 inhibits Wnt/β-catenin signaling. (A) Western blotting was used to detect β-catenin levels after PARP1 immunoprecipitation in HEK293T cells transfected with vector pLC5-ciR and pLC5-circATM plasmids. (B) Western blotting analysis of circATM binding to β-catenin in the circRNA pull-down assay. (C) Western blotting analysis of PARP1 levels in HEK293T cells transfected with vector pLC5-ciR and pLC5-circATM plasmids after β-catenin immunoprecipitation. (D) TOPflash and FOPflash reporter assays were carried out to measure the transcriptional activity of TCF/β-catenin in AGS cells. (E) Wnt/β-catenin targets were detected by RT-qPCR after circATM siRNA transfection of AGS cells. (F) Wnt/β-catenin targets were detected by western blotting after circATM siRNA transfection of AGS cells. (G) The effect of circATM overexpression on Wnt/β-catenin targets in AGS cells transfected with si_circATM. * p <0.05, ** p <0.01, *** p <0.001.
